Veotoro Management LLC Implements SunGard's Kiodex SaaS Solution for Commodity Trading and Risk Management
Veotoro Management, a Miami-based commodity hedge fund, has implemented SunGard's Kiodex Risk Workbench for commodity trading and risk management. Veotoro will use Kiodex to manage portfolio risk using a range of reports for risk analysis, profit and loss, attribution, mark to market and Value at Risk (VaR). Kiodex will support the new fund's relative value trading strategy in commodities and in the global energy sector.

Commodity Trading With Stochastic Oscillators
The stochastic oscillator was developed in the late fifties by George Lane. It is an oscillator which shows momentum in a commodity by comparing the current day's close to the high/low ranges over a specified amount of days. Consistent closings near the higher side of the range indicates buying pressure while a close consistently on the lower side of the range indicates weakness and selling pressure. Moving Averages And Their Uses In Commodity Trading
A key component of technical analysis and perhaps one of the oldest indicators around, moving averages are time-tested and affective indicators. There are many types of moving averages with varying indicators, but the primary purpose of all types of moving averages remains the same. Their purpose is to reduce or remove noise from the daily price movements and attracted trends of stocks, commodities or any thing you can plot or chart.

Enron Commodity Trading was Not Original
If one were to go an annual report for El Paso Energy from 2000; they would find on page 11 of the shareholders report a picture of their 80,000 square foot trading floor, with 700 merchant staff. Enron many thought had in fact originated this; once upon a time claiming to be the largest in the world energy trading floor.

Commodity Trading Involves Some Risk With Big Rewards
Commodity trading is the buying and selling of contracts of items that we use everyday. It is the trading of primary or raw products. Some of the items traded in the commodities market include such common, everyday items as: soy beans, cotton, orange juice, cocoa, sugar, wheat, corn, barley, pork bellies, milk, feedstuffs, fruits, vegetables, other grains, other beans, hay, other livestock, meats, poultry, and eggs. Energy items that are traded on the commodity markets include oil, natural gas, electricity, and gasoline. The commodity speculators in the energy market were blamed for the recent price increase in the cost of gasoline at the pump.
